Number 8 With a Bullet
In 2008, Bungie made the ‘Develop 100’ – a list, put together by Develop Magazine, of the top 100 most successful game studios in the world (as measured by sales the previous year in the UK). They were #8, presumably based in large part on the sales of Halo 3. By 2010, they’d dropped to #16 – but it looks like they’re back up to #8 on the 2011 list (which is now calculated based on Metacritic score, rather than UK sales data). ‘Halo: CE’ action figures to debut at E3
NeoGAF’s wwm0nkey pointed out a new Play Arts Halo action figure line from Square Enix. The two new figures shown are from “Halo: CE” and will debut at this year’s E3. The figures are envisioned by Square Enix, which might account for the discernible changes in the Mark V armor. How intriguing. Update: Frankie stopped by to elaborate on the action figures. According to him, the figures pull in design elements from every variant of the Chief to create unique, Japanese-flavored celebration items for the 10th anniversary. ‘Halo and Philosophy’ cover, release date
Back in March, Hedgemony found the abstracts for a book titled “Halo and Philosophy.” According to Amazon, the 288-page book will be available next Tuesday. Also included in the listing is the book’s cover. The list price is $20, but Amazon is selling it for $13.01. Update: Arithmomaniac let us know the book is shipping now (and that there’s a Kindle version), and atticboy showed us a photo of the book in L.A.’s Little Tokyo.
